From rmware version 2.0 onwards the LCD display has been activated and the following information can
be found on the display.
In normal operation the LumiNode will step through the port overview pages depending on the total
amount of ports on the model. If more than 4 ports are available, the display will change every 5 seconds.
The following image is showing the layout of the display:
(A) Short name of the device (default is the model of the device).
(B) IP address/Netmask ( /8 = 255.0.0.0, /16=255.255.0.0, /24=255.255.255.0). If advanced networking is
congured, the LCD display will not be showing the IP conguration.
(C) Port number.
(D) Shows if the port is an input or an output.
(E) Shows the mode of the process engine.
For a more detailed view per port, you can use the jog wheel and scroll to the right.
Example of detailed port info:
(A) Port number you are viewing.
(B) When the RDM icon is showing, RDM is enabled on this port.
(C) Shows if the port is an input or an output.
(D) Shows the input of the process engine, what protocol and which universe.
(E) Displays which process engine is linked, what mode the process engine is in, if there is a patch or if the
master/limit has been set.
(F) Shows the output of the process engine, universe number and protocol.
